:) Cocricco takes a little finding, but it's useful in a somewhat barren eating area - BUT take a crossword! They cook from scratch, in leisurely fashion, but the results are good (e.g. chicken pilau, Tobago style). Ciao is a small Italian ice-creamery/bar in the Burnett St part of town: excellent icecream, and lasagne.
